Discover Únanov
Únanov brings together water-based activities, protected nature, and local culture within a compact area. Those travelling with children will find several opportunities for a varied stay at the Koupaliště Pohoda complex, while anyone seeking landscapes and distinctive species can discover natural monuments and valuable habitats in the surrounding area. There is also a church with Gothic architectural features, modern sacred architecture, and festivals that showcase the local character.
Water, Play and Exercise
Koupaliště Pohoda offers a swimming pool and a leisure pool. For younger visitors, the facilities include a children's pool, a slide, a water slide, and a water cave. Massage loungers provide an additional way to relax. The complex also includes adjacent sports courts and a children's playground. This makes it possible to combine different activities in the same area without limiting the day to a single pool.
There are also concrete options for active time together. The Koupaliště Pohoda grounds include two tennis courts with an artificial surface and a multi-purpose court for ball games. At the edge of Únanov in the direction of Plaveč, you will also find FitPark, an outdoor fitness centre for several generations. The range therefore extends from water fun and play to sports facilities for different age groups.
Protected Landscape and Rare Species
PP Losolosy is located near Únanov and is one of three areas protected as natural monuments. PP Losolosy protects heat-loving plant communities and provides habitats for protected plants and several bird species. The nearby EVL Kopečky u Únanova consists of two steppe hills northeast of Únanov and complements this landscape with a clearly defined geological and botanical character.
The PP Kopečky u Únanova natural monument protects dry and heat-loving plant communities with numerous rare and endangered plant and animal species. Particular attention is given to the highly endangered great pasque flower, scientifically known as Pulsatilla grandis. PP Kaolinka is also an area of significant scientific value. The Italian crested newt, Triturus carnifex, is found there; the area is also home to other rare plant and animal species associated with wetland and disturbed-site habitats. Church, Chapel and Local Traditions
The Church of Saint Procopius in Únanov preserves Gothic architectural features in the presbytery and the lower part of the tower. A modern architectural contrast is provided by the Chapel of the Virgin Mary and Saint John Paul II. It stands on the northwestern edge of Únanov. Anyone who wants to experience not only leisure activities but also different forms of sacred architecture during their trip will find two distinct places to visit here.
The local events calendar includes the traditional Únanovské posvícení, a festival featuring a weekend full of music, dancing, and entertainment. Practical Information for Your Stay
For travel by public transport, IDS-JMK route 811 serves the Únanov, závod stop. The campsite is located on the edge of the village in the immediate vicinity of the Koupaliště Pohoda outdoor swimming pool and is separated from it by a fence.
